Transaction 3d3636b03ca7552b30c2d69bb713dc4e5ec4b4a779becbea5a211a17eee5521e
1 Input
2 Outputs
- 3d3636b03ca7552b30c2d69bb713dc4e5ec4b4a779becbea5a211a17eee5521e:0
- 3d3636b03ca7552b30c2d69bb713dc4e5ec4b4a779becbea5a211a17eee5521e:1
value 6412070
address 1P1G7ouTuhoPtmXDxxMz796SPHTxwfPLp2
value 802694024
address 3JynJhtx9yuouSPh4k3eNAKC8EjNf6RgyW